On Vendor Payments, you can make payouts to vendors against the invoices you receive from them. You can receive and import the invoice through email, Vendor Portal, upload the PDF on RazorpayX Dashboard or enter the details manually.

Add Invoices through Email

When you add invoices in RazorpayX, you allow your vendors to send invoices to you via your business email. You have the option to forward these emails to the dedicated email address provided to you by RazorpayX. When you forward them to that email address, RazorpayX automatically generates a corresponding invoice on the Dashboard. You do not have to manually update the details, or upload invoices for the OCR to read them.

Mark Invoice as Paid

You may have uploaded an invoice on the Dashboard but paid it externally. In such cases, you can mark the invoice as paid via the RazorpayX Dashboard.
  • The invoice moves to the paid state without creating a corresponding payout.
  • When you mark an invoice as paid, you can select the external method you chose to pay the invoice (such as bank transfer, cheque or cash).
  • Invoices marked as paid are considered for TDS payments. You can calculate and pay the TDS using Tax Payments.
This makes Vendor Payments an end-to-end solution to track all your vendor payments, irrespective of the payment method and gives you an accurate bookkeeping summary. Watch this video to know how to mark an invoice as paid or read along. To mark an invoice as paid:
  1. Log in to the RazorpayX Dashboard.
  2. Navigate to MenuVendor Payments.
  3. Click on the relevant invoice from the list to mark as paid .
  4. In the invoice summary page, hover on the downward arrow against the PAY/SCHEDULE button. Click MARK AS PAID from the drop-down list.
  5. Choose the payment mode in the Mark as paid pop-up page and click MARK PAID.
You have successfully marked the invoice as paid.
Watch Out!Once marked as paid, you cannot change the invoice status to unpaid.
